thredUP

thredUP is the online shop for like-new kids clothes that delivers family-favorite brands at low prices. Families can earn cash by sending in their lightly worn hand-me-downs to thredUP, and shop hundreds of brands at up to 75% off retail prices. Why? Because clothes don’t grow, kids do!
